Transaction 678c6421a7e3ae296cb517ff11ed159e58e8e3343ff49475741a865425fffee9
1 Input
2 Outputs
- 678c6421a7e3ae296cb517ff11ed159e58e8e3343ff49475741a865425fffee9:0
- 678c6421a7e3ae296cb517ff11ed159e58e8e3343ff49475741a865425fffee9:1
value 67521400
address 168sZzg79WGnHysnSw85L3Y5H8rDnD7fzH
value 911787060
address 1CwCvtQPQDszsCN42LHocQBjeertuUJ2f7